The Murphy Scholars of Archbishop Molloy High School attend unique and inspiring summer leadership programs at colleges and universities. To date, Scholars have participated in enrichment programs at Rutgers University, Princeton University, Stony Brook University, Wake Forest University, and the United States Naval Academy.
Through the Fund For Molloy, the Murphy Scholars Program provides grants up to $1,000 per student, empowering them to enjoy this enriching program. Br. Declan Murray, FMS, was a beloved educator and mentor who taught at Molloy for over 50 years. Br. Declan helped pioneer Molloy's retreat and encounter programs, as well as Freshman Camp, all held at the Marist Brothers' Center at Esopus. This tradition has had a lasting impact on thousands of Stanners since its inception in 1977. Esopus is a home away from home for many in our community.

Mr. Lou Santos, known to many as "Uncle Lou" or "Coach Lou," has served the Molloy community for over 40 years as a teacher, coach, mentor, and friend. In appreciation of the lifetime of service and charity Lou dedicated to Molloy, our alumni have created this wonderful scholarship in Lou's honor. The Lou Santos Scholarship benefits Catholic students with demonstrated financial need.
